Responsibilities:

  • Operate tills, handle cash, and deliver outstanding customer service
  • Prepare hot and cold drinks, serve food, and keep counters stocked
  • Make grab-and-go items like sandwiches, wraps, and paninis
  • Maintain cleanliness front and back of house, ensuring high standards of hygiene and safety
  • Receive and store deliveries, ensuring proper stock rotation and minimal waste

Qualifications:

  • Legal right to work in the UK and ability to pass security vetting and DBS checks (residency waivers available)
  • At least 12 months’ previous experience in a similar role in a busy kitchen or food service environment
  • A positive attitude and commitment to excellent customer service
